Abstract

An internal finish-grinding machine of the type comprising a frame carrying a rotatable grinding wheel and also supporting an axially movable table which itself carries a rotatable support for a workpiece has the table pivotally mounted on a single horizontal spindle which also forms a guide rail along which the table is axially movable. The spindle extends over a major part of the length of the grinder to give the table widely based support and the spindle is situated in a substantially vertical plane containing the axis of rotation of the workpiece support. The spindle is mounted in the lower part of the machine frame in order to maximize the distance between the axis of the spindle and the axis of rotation of the workpiece support. This ensures that there is a minimum deviation in the shape of the finish-ground workpiece brought about by wear of the periphery of the grinding wheel.
